Intro to Robotics

An introductory robotics workshop for teens and middle school students at the Wheaton Public Library.

Sat, 6 Jun 2026 11:00 AM – 12:30 PM (America/Chicago) Wheaton Public Library Wheaton , Illinois
Discover the exciting world of technology at the Intro to Robotics workshop, hosted by the Wheaton Public Library. Designed specifically for teens and middle school students, this hands-on session provides a great introduction to robotics concepts and programming. Whether you are a beginner or have some experience, this workshop offers a fun and educational environment to learn and create. Join us on June 6, 2026, from 11:00 AM to 12:30 PM in Meeting Room C.
